What do you mean by past grudges?

In Buddhism and Taoism, there is a concept of "karma", which means that people's good and evil behaviors in their previous lives will get corresponding retribution in this life. In other words, the causal relationship established in the previous life will be reflected in this life, which is a feud in the previous life.

The gratitude and resentment in previous lives are reflected in the national fortune, family, health and wealth in this life. For example, the good deeds or misfortunes accumulated in the last life may be reflected in this life. Therefore, all kinds of problems faced by people in this life may be the embodiment of past grievances.

In order to solve the grievances of past lives, we need to practice, eliminate our own evil thoughts and clean up the bad karma of past lives. Good karma can be accumulated by doing good deeds and giving. If you encounter setbacks, you need to try your best to adjust your attitude and avoid further deepening the causal relationship. Through constant practice and hard work, we can resolve past grievances and make ourselves better.
